/*
 * MAX_CAR_HOLD_MS — Liftwright elevator-dispatch simulator.
 * Caps how long a simulated car may idle at a lobby call
 * before the dispatcher reassigns it. Raising this above
 * 4000 skews the morning-rush scenarios and invalidates
 * our Ostermere benchmark baselines. If you're on call and
 * must change it, note that the baseline run was produced
 * under the build token recorded just below.
 */

trace token, kafof-yahif: htk21_135de011c73c8ae9f0c72

First-day checklist — item 7: Mail room has moved!

Quick one for contractors starting at Dunmore Yard this week: the mail room is no longer by the loading bay. It's now tucked behind the café on Level 1 — follow the yellow floor arrows and you can't miss it. Any kit deliveries addressed to you will be held there, so swing by before lunch on day one. The door is on the secure side, so punch in the code below.

staff pass of kagup-fajog = bdg-QCHVQW-99665837

### Runbook: Echohall Audio Guide

If visitors report that tour stops won't load in the Echohall app, it's almost always the stream cache. First, check the Soundpost dashboard for stale manifests — anything older than two hours is suspect. Flush the cache via the admin endpoint, wait about a minute, and ask the visitor to restart the app. Don't flush during peak hours unless it's fully down. The flush endpoint authenticates against our internal Soundpost service with the key below.

gateway credential: qvz7-vWy80ME

Rebuilds on Larkspur are incremental: only pages whose source files changed are regenerated. If the manifest hash drifts, the build silently falls back to a full rebuild—watch for that in timing logs. Never delete the cache directory mid-build. Steps for forcing a clean incremental pass are documented on the page linked below.

dashboard of tajef-tawef = https://jira.qorvellabs.internal/browse/projects/display/pages/cdad